The Receptionist is the face of the organization, and he/she is responsible for being the first point of contact for the Dubai Branch for people making contact with the Company either in person or telephone.

All personnel are expected to contribute to creating a positive HSEQ culture within Subsea 7 and ensure familiarity with and adherence to local HSEQ codes and practices.

All personnel are also expected to contribute to creating a culture of ethics and integrity within Subsea 7 and ensure familiarity with and adherence to our Code of Conduct.

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Greet and welcome guests as soon as they arrive at the office and assist them to log in to our Teams-go system and print their visitor’s pass.
  • Direct visitors to the appropriate person in all floors
  • Answer, screen and forward incoming phone calls and providing basic and accurate information in-person and via phone/email.
  • Ensure reception area is tidy and presentable, with all necessary stationery and material (e.g. pens, forms and brochures)
  • Maintain office security by following safety procedures and controlling access via the reception desk (monitor logbook, issue visitor badges)
  • Order front office supplies and keep inventory of stock.
  • Update meeting room calendars and schedule meetings
  • Keep updated records of office expenses and cost.
  • coordinating with HSE team for arranging visitors’ HSE office induction and updating the welcome presentation to be displayed on the TV screens.
  • Takes delivery of parcels/documents, ensuring they reach their intended recipient. Also, arranges documents and parcels to be despatched as instructed, either by mail or by courier. Maintain register.
  • Assist the Facilities Administrator in the administration of the Parking slots allotted to management.
  • Activation/Deactivation of Roaming services and maintain register.
  • Checking office supplies (pantry/stationeries) and ordering same where necessary.
